Document Transport — Paper Ledger Archiving. When the quarterly ledgers from the Rookwell branch are ready for deep storage, box them spine-up in the lined archive cartons, two per carton, with the index card taped inside the lid. Seal each carton, note the seal numbers on the manifest, and stage them at bay 2. Hollis Secure Transit collects on the last Friday of the month. The collecting driver must follow the hand-over instruction given below.

handover note for hafop-yageg: the soriel tamys courier leaves the tamdor quenok aldvan ledger at gate 5357 under passcode 293424

## 3.2.0 — Changed defaults

Squeegee's SQL linting defaults have changed. Uppercase keywords are now enforced (previously advisory), trailing commas in SELECT lists are rejected, and the max line length dropped from 160 to 120. Rules touching vendor-specific syntax are disabled unless a dialect is declared. Reviewers should expect churn in older migration files; a bulk autofix landed in the same release, so flag only hand-edited violations. CI uses the shared profile, so local overrides are ignored. The effective defaults now resolve to:

settings of bafof-fajog:
[aldix]
port = 9300
region = north-3
host = aldix.kelvilabs.example
team = istath
timeout_ms = 1500
retries = 8

Handover — Veltrane Works capacity decision

To: incoming director. Decision pending on adding a third shift at the Osmund Bay plant versus contracting overflow to Kelbrook Fabrication. Cost models are in the shared planning folder; Kelbrook quote expires end of month. Branch managers have been told nothing yet. Recommend deciding within two weeks. Background reasoning for the preferred option is appended below.

confidential, kagep-kahof: Druokax Systems plans to lower the Ulaath list price by 53 percent in March.

### Health checks failing behind the Marloweave LB?

First thing: the balancer probes /healthz every five seconds, and two misses pulls the node. Nine times out of ten it's the app taking too long on a cold cache, not an actual outage — check startup logs before paging anyone. You can probe nodes directly through the debug proxy; it needs auth, so use the bearer token below.

session JWT of yawep-yawep = eyJhbGciOiJIUzI1NiIsInR5cCI6IkpXVCJ9.eyJzdWIiOiI3pWF3_In0.aXYsHiog